8 reasons to hire an interior design for your next project

As you embark on your next design project, you may find yourself contemplating whether to hire an interior designer or go the DIY route. While taking on the project yourself can be exciting, there are numerous advantages to enlisting the expertise of a professional interior designer. In this blog post, we'll explore eight compelling reasons why hiring an interior designer can elevate your design experience and help you achieve the space of your dreams.


1. Design Expertise and Knowledge

Interior designers possess a wealth of design expertise and knowledge that can transform your space. With a deep understanding of design principles, color schemes, spatial planning, and materials, they can provide valuable insights and guidance, ensuring a cohesive and aesthetically pleasing result.

2. Time-Saving and Stress Relief

Designing a space involves countless decisions, research, and coordination. By hiring an interior designer, you can delegate these tasks to a professional, saving you time and alleviating the stress associated with managing a complex project. They will handle the nitty-gritty details, allowing you to focus on enjoying the creative process.

3. Budget Management

Working with a budget is crucial for any design project. Interior designers are adept at helping you establish and manage a budget, ensuring that your resources are allocated wisely. Their expertise in working with various price points can help you make informed decisions and maximize the value of your investment.

4. Access to Resources and Contacts

Interior designers have access to an extensive network of resources, including furniture, fabrics, materials, and decor items. They can tap into their connections and supplier relationships to source high-quality products and materials that suit your style and budget. This access to exclusive resources can significantly enhance the overall look and feel of your space.

5. Space Planning and Functionality

Optimizing space and ensuring functionality is a cornerstone of interior design. Designers are skilled in space planning, considering factors such as furniture placement, traffic flow, and storage solutions. Their expertise will help you make the most of your available space while ensuring a seamless and functional design.

6. Personalized Style and Aesthetics

Interior designers excel at translating your vision and preferences into a personalized design scheme. They take the time to understand your lifestyle, tastes, and aspirations, and then infuse these elements into the design. By incorporating your unique style and aesthetics, they create a space that feels like a true reflection of your personality.

7. Attention to Detail

Every successful design lies in the details. Interior designers have a keen eye for the finer elements of design, such as lighting, textures, patterns, and finishes. They pay meticulous attention to these details, ensuring that every aspect of your space is cohesive, harmonious, and visually appealing.

8. Increased Property Value

A well-designed space can significantly increase the value of your property. By hiring an interior designer, you are investing in the expertise needed to create a visually stunning and functional space that appeals to potential buyers or tenants. Their knowledge of market trends and design strategies can help you maximize your property's market value.

One of the first questions clients ask is ‘how much will it cost?’ Many interior designers will charge a flat fee for the entire project, with costs in London ranging from £5,000 for a small project to £250,000+ for multi-million pound developments.
